pub struct DiagnosticsReporter<'a> { /* private fields */ }
Expand description

Collects compilation diagnostics and presents them in preconfigured way.

Implementations§

source§

impl DiagnosticsReporter<'static>

source

pub fn ignoring() -> Self

Create a reporter which does not print or collect diagnostics at all.

source

pub fn stderr() -> Self

Create a reporter which prints all diagnostics to std::io::Stderr.

source§

impl<'a> DiagnosticsReporter<'a>

source

pub fn callback(callback: impl FnMut(String) + 'a) -> Self

Create a reporter which calls callback for each diagnostic.

source

pub fn write_to_string(string: &'a mut String) -> Self

Create a reporter which appends all diagnostics to provided string.

source

pub fn check(&mut self, db: &RootDatabase) -> bool

Checks if there are diagnostics and reports them to the provided callback as strings. Returns true if diagnostics were found.

source

pub fn ensure(&mut self, db: &RootDatabase) -> Result<(), DiagnosticsError>

Checks if there are diagnostics and reports them to the provided callback as strings. Returns Err if diagnostics were found.
